"The Natural History Museum is home to one of the largest natural history collections in the world. They wanted to create a new identity that successfully communicated their diversity as a museum, not just its exhibits, but of its research and scientific credentials. A key part of the strategy underlying the rebrand was to create a total experience for the three million or more visitors each year, while maintaining visual consistency. The solution took 'The Power of Nature' as a theme; it's expressed through a palette of 35 images by leading wildlife photographers, ranging from microscopic plankton to a satellite shot of the earth."
